All women's Lady Sevenstar team to enter 2013 Phang Nga Bay Regatta
Tue, 8 Jan 2013
'It can be quite daunting for a woman to hold her own amongst male sailors aboard a yacht, therefore I am happy to present Lady Sevenstar, the first all-female sailing team to enter the 2013 Bay Regatta', says Marieke Derks, Lady Sevenstar captain and marketing representative of Sevenstar Yacht Transport. The Lady Sevenstar team consists of women with all levels of sailing skills: highly competetive, professional sailors, occasional weekend yachtswomen and even an absolute novice. Marieke says 'Joining a yacht race provides opportunities for women to learn and enhance their sailing skills but also to have fun and meet others. By creating a supportive atmosphere on board we hope to see more women join us on the water.'
The team’s sponsor, Sevenstar Yacht Transport's recently appointed agent in Thailand, Chris Jongerius of Andaman Sea Club, was immediately enthusiastic about an all women's team. He generously provided the team with one of his catamarans, a Firefly 850 sports cat designed by Mark Pescott, and built in Phuket. Developed for the tropics Firefly cats always stand out from the crowd. These fast and fun sailing boats are strong and lightweight to give them fantastic boat speed, even in days of little wind.
Since sleeping on board Lady Sevenstar is not possible for the whole team of seven, Captain Brian Calvert, voyaging around the world on his motoryacht Furthur, a Selene 482 , kindly volunteered his yacht to act as hotel and support vessel. Team Lady Sevenstar is looking forward to sailing under sunny skies through the stunning scenery of Phuket, Phang Nga Bay and Krabi. Towering limestone cliffs and a beautiful seascape form a perfect backdrop for one of the most enjoyable sailing events in the region and evenings of get togethers and fun regatta parties.
The 2013 Bay Regatta runs from 30 January to 2 February and is organised by the Ao Chalong Yacht Club, Phuket.
